CSA Cosmic Increases Stake in PLO Association to 100% with 4.1 Billion Won Acquisition
Finance · Investment Managers · yonhap_finance · 2026-09-09
083660
KOSDAQ-listed CSA Cosmic has acquired an additional 41,000 shares of investment firm PLO Association for 4.1 billion won, securing full ownership.
What Happened
Acquisition Details: KOSDAQ-listed company CSA Cosmic announced the acquisition of 41,000 additional shares in the investment firm PLO Association. The transaction is valued at 4.1 billion won, bringing CSA Cosmic's total stake in the entity to 100%.
Strategic Rationale: The company stated that the primary purpose of this acquisition is to optimize the management of its financial assets and improve overall investment returns. This move is intended to streamline their portfolio and enhance capital efficiency.
Transaction Timeline: The acquisition was scheduled to be completed on the day of the disclosure, September 9th. The transaction was processed following standard regulatory filing procedures.
